Mixed methods were applied to examine the association of community participation by disabled youth with socioeconomic factors in rural Sri Lanka. There was a significant association between community participation and socioeconomic factors in the quantitative survey (n = 116): participants living in socioeconomically disadvantaged conditions had lower levels of community participation than those living without these disadvantages. Consistent with the findings of the survey, previous educational experiences, household economic conditions, and perceived resource information were common themes in the qualitative study (n = 26). The dynamics of these factors, including marginalisation of disabled youth within the household, were also observed. 相似文献

The purpose of this study was to explore the relationship between job engagement and two key components of employee-organization relationships (EOR). Findings from a survey of members of the Millennial Generation (N = 539) in the United States indicate that job engagement mediates the relationship between employee communication and organizational commitment. It is concluded that when employees are engaged in their work, their commitment to the organization is strengthened and the likelihood of them leaving the organization decreases. Furthermore, an argument is made in light of the study’s findings that engagement and commitment work in concert to strengthen EORs overall. To foster engagement, organizations should remove obstacles to internal information flow and provide ongoing feedback to employees about individual and organizational issues. 相似文献

Suicidal tendencies are typically considered related to individual traits or predispositions, but some occupations have significantly higher rates than other occupations and the general population. This article proposes that stressful work conditions may be important in understanding occupational variations in suicidal tendencies. It explores the links between work-related factors and burnout, and suicidal thoughts among veterinarians. Burnout appears to be an important mediator in understanding veterinarians’ suicidal tendencies; work conditions that are emotionally exhausting for veterinarians may foster suicidal thoughts. Individual coping strategies are also explored. Emotion-focused strategies of avoidance and alcohol consumption not only exacerbate burnout and suicidal thoughts but also amplify the harmful effects of some job demands. Active problem solving is not as beneficial as expected, but a supportive work environment is a valuable coping resource. Organizational interventions and coping resources effective in reducing burnout may also reduce the risk of suicide for those in service occupations. 相似文献

The purpose of this study was to determine how the ostracism of K-12 teachers influences their commitment to their schools and commitment to the teaching profession. The investment model was used to situate ostracism as a predictor of teacher commitment. Participants were 200 full-time K-12 teachers who completed a survey assessing their experiences with ostracism at work and investment model variables (i.e., investments, quality of alternatives, satisfaction, and commitment). Results confirmed investment model predictions with teachers’ investments, quality of alternatives, and satisfaction predicting their commitment to their schools and profession. Results of mediation models also demonstrated that controlling for teachers’ investments and quality of alternatives, ostracism predicted commitment indirectly through its effect on satisfaction. This study revealed that teacher commitment is explained by investment model predictions, but after controlling for those predictions, is further explained by ostracism from teacher colleagues. 相似文献

In most of the existing specialized literature, monitoring regression models are a special case of profile monitoring. However, not every regression model always represents appropriately a profile data structure. This is clearly the case of the Weibull regression model (WRM) with common shape parameter γ. Even though it might be thought that existing methodologies (especially likelihood-ratio (LRT)-based methods) for monitoring generalized linear profiles can also be successfully applied to monitoring regression models with time-to-event response, it will be shown in this paper that those methodologies work fairly acceptable just for data structures with 1000 observations at least approximately. It was found out that some corrections, often referred to as Bartlett's adjustments, are needed to be implemented in order to improve the accuracy of using the asymptotic distributional properties of the LRT statistic for carrying out the monitoring of WRM with relatively small and moderate dimensions of the available datasets. Simulation studies suggest that the use of the aforementioned corrections make the resulting charts work quite acceptable when available data structures contain 30 observations at least. Detection abilities of the proposed schemes improve as dataset dimension increases. 相似文献

The problem of interaction selection in high-dimensional data analysis has recently received much attention. This note aims to address and clarify several fundamental issues in interaction selection for linear regression models, especially when the input dimension p is much larger than the sample size n. We first discuss how to give a formal definition of “importance” for main and interaction effects. Then we focus on two-stage methods, which are computationally attractive for high-dimensional data analysis but thus far have been regarded as heuristic. We revisit the counterexample of Turlach and provide new insight to justify two-stage methods from the theoretical perspective. In the end, we suggest new strategies for interaction selection under the marginality principle and provide some simulation results. 相似文献

A significant challenge in fitting metamodels of large-scale simulations with sufficient accuracy is in the computational time required for rigorous statistical validation. This paper addresses the statistical computation issues associated with the Bootstrap and modified PRESS statistic, which yield key metrics for error measurements in metamodelling validation. Experimentation is performed on different programming languages, namely, MATLAB, R, and Python, and implemented on different computing architectures including traditional multicore personal computers and high-power clusters with parallel computing capabilities. This study yields insight into the effect that programming languages and computing architecture have on the computational time for simulation metamodel validation. The experimentation is performed across two scenarios with varying complexity. 相似文献

In long-memory data sets such as the realized volatilities of financial assets, a sequential test is developed for the detection of structural mean breaks. The long memory, if any, is adjusted by fitting an HAR (heterogeneous autoregressive) model to the data sets and taking the residuals. Our test consists of applying the sequential test of Bai and Perron [Estimating and testing linear models with multiple structural changes. Econometrica. 1998;66:47–78] to the residuals. The large-sample validity of the proposed test is investigated in terms of the consistency of the estimated number of breaks and the asymptotic null distribution of the proposed test. A finite-sample Monte-Carlo experiment reveals that the proposed test tends to produce an unbiased break time estimate, while the usual sequential test of Bai and Perron tends to produce biased break times in the case of long memory. The experiment also reveals that the proposed test has a more stable size than the Bai and Perron test. The proposed test is applied to two realized volatility data sets of the S&P index and the Korea won-US dollar exchange rate for the past 7 years and finds 2 or 3 breaks, while the Bai and Perron test finds 8 or more breaks. 相似文献

Since the seminal paper by Cook and Weisberg [9], local influence, next to case deletion, has gained popularity as a tool to detect influential subjects and measurements for a variety of statistical models. For the linear mixed model the approach leads to easily interpretable and computationally convenient expressions, not only highlighting influential subjects, but also which aspect of their profile leads to undue influence on the model's fit [17]. Ouwens et al. [24] applied the method to the Poisson-normal generalized linear mixed model (GLMM). Given the model's nonlinear structure, these authors did not derive interpretable components but rather focused on a graphical depiction of influence. In this paper, we consider GLMMs for binary, count, and time-to-event data, with the additional feature of accommodating overdispersion whenever necessary. For each situation, three approaches are considered, based on: (1) purely numerical derivations; (2) using a closed-form expression of the marginal likelihood function; and (3) using an integral representation of this likelihood. Unlike when case deletion is used, this leads to interpretable components, allowing not only to identify influential subjects, but also to study the cause thereof. The methodology is illustrated in case studies that range over the three data types mentioned. 相似文献
